Climate Overview
São Paulo
Subtropical highland — warm and humid with no distinct dry season
São Paulo sits at 2,500 feet (760m) elevation, making it cooler than its tropical latitude would suggest. The city receives substantial year-round rainfall. Winters (June–August) are the dry season with mild, clear weather. Summers bring intense afternoon thunderstorms.
Paris
Semi-oceanic — mild with four distinct seasons, regular rainfall
Paris has a pleasant climate with warm summers and cool winters. Spring and fall are the most popular seasons for a reason — mild temperatures, manageable crowds, and the city at its most photogenic. Summers can have heat waves; winters are cold but rarely harsh.
Seasonal Comparison
| Season | 🇧🇷 São Paulo | 🇫🇷 Paris |
|---|---|---|
| Spring | 61–77°F September–November | 46–66°F March–May |
| Summer | 66–82°F December–February | 64–79°F June–August |
| Fall | 61–75°F March–May | 50–66°F September–November |
| Winter | 55–70°F June–August | 36–46°F December–February |
